Necklace with peridot and citrine, goldsmith’s work, 21st cent.

Stamped: 925/- silver, gilt; serrated ring clasp and spacer discs; satin-finished surface; total weight: approx. 52.8 g; mounted at repeating intervals and in segments faceted peridot discs and compressed spherical citrines, circumferentially faceted in a diamond pattern; diameter: approx. 7.5 mm to approx. 9.5 mm; overall length: approx. 47 cm.
